3DS模拟器实战指南:精通Citra实现3DS游戏电脑运行
想要在个人电脑上流畅体验3DS游戏吗?通过Citra模拟器,你可以将任天堂3DS平台的经典游戏带到电脑屏幕上,享受更高清的画质和更灵活的操作方式。本指南将以问题解决为导向,带你一步步掌握从环境配置到游戏优化的全流程技巧,让3DS游戏电脑运行不再困难。
评估运行环境:硬件与系统兼容性检测
在开始使用Citra模拟器前,首先需要确认你的电脑是否具备运行3DS游戏的基本条件。以下是关键配置的对比分析:
| 硬件类别 | 最低配置 | 推荐配置 | 常见问题 |
|---|---|---|---|
| 操作系统 | Windows 10 64位、macOS 10.15或Linux发行版 | Windows 11、macOS 12或最新Linux内核 | 32位系统不支持;老旧系统可能缺少必要组件 |
| 处理器 | 支持AVX2指令集的双核CPU | Intel Core i5/Ryzen 5及以上 | 低电压处理器可能导致帧率不足 |
| 内存 | 4GB RAM | 8GB RAM | 内存不足会导致游戏加载缓慢或崩溃 |
| 显卡 | 支持OpenGL 4.3的集成显卡 | NVIDIA GTX 1050/AMD RX 560及以上 | 老旧显卡可能无法支持高级渲染特性 |
Citra模拟器系统配置检测界面示意图
专家提示:不确定自己的硬件是否达标?可以通过CPU-Z查看处理器是否支持AVX2指令集,使用GPU-Z检查显卡支持的OpenGL版本。
获取模拟器:从源码到安装的完整路径
获取Citra模拟器有多种方式,这里我们采用源码编译的方式,确保获得最新功能:
- 访问项目仓库页面,找到"克隆或下载"按钮
- 选择"下载ZIP"选项保存到本地(或使用Git工具克隆仓库)
- 解压下载的压缩包到合适的位置
- 双击运行解压目录中的安装程序,按向导完成安装
Citra模拟器下载页面示意图
专家提示:建议将模拟器安装在固态硬盘(SSD)上,可显著提升游戏加载速度。安装完成后,记得勾选"创建桌面快捷方式"以便快速访问。
配置决策树:根据硬件选择最佳设置方案
选择合适的模拟器配置是获得良好游戏体验的关键。以下决策树将帮助你根据硬件情况做出正确选择:
图形后端选择
- 低端集成显卡 → 选择OpenGL后端
- 中端独立显卡 → 尝试Vulkan后端
- 高端显卡 → Vulkan后端+多线程渲染
分辨率设置
- 性能优先 → 原生分辨率(400x240)
- 平衡方案 → 2x分辨率(800x480)
- 画质优先 → 4x分辨率(1600x960),需高端显卡支持
Citra配置决策树流程图
专家提示:首次配置时建议使用"默认设置"进行测试,记录帧率表现后再逐步调整参数。每次只修改一个设置项,便于定位性能变化的原因。
加载游戏文件:从获取到启动的操作指南
成功运行游戏需要正确的文件和操作流程:
支持的游戏文件格式
- .3ds:原始游戏卡带镜像文件
- .cia:可安装的3DS游戏包格式
- .cxi:精简的可执行游戏文件
游戏加载步骤
- 启动Citra模拟器
- 点击主界面的"文件"菜单
- 选择"加载文件"选项
- 浏览并选择你的游戏文件
- 等待游戏加载完成(首次加载可能需要较长时间)
专家提示:建议将游戏文件统一存放在一个目录中,并定期备份。游戏文件校验和可以通过Citra的"校验文件"功能进行验证,确保文件完整性。
排查启动故障:从文件到驱动的全流程
遇到游戏无法启动的情况,可按以下步骤排查:
-
检查游戏文件
- 确认文件格式是否被支持
- 验证文件大小是否正常(通常在几百MB到4GB之间)
- 尝试重新获取游戏文件
-
更新系统组件
- 安装最新的显卡驱动
- 更新DirectX和Visual C++运行库
- 确保系统已安装所有Windows更新
-
调整模拟器设置
- 尝试禁用"硬件着色器"
- 降低分辨率和画质设置
- 关闭不必要的功能如"纹理过滤"
专家提示:Citra的日志文件可以提供详细的错误信息,位于"文件→打开日志目录"。遇到问题时,可以查看日志了解具体错误原因。
优化游戏性能:提升帧率的实用技巧
即使配置达标,也可能需要一些优化来获得最佳体验:
基础优化
- 关闭后台不必要的程序,释放系统资源
- 将电源计划设置为"高性能"(笔记本用户)
- 确保笔记本处于散热良好的环境
高级设置
- 启用"异步着色器编译"减少卡顿
- 调整"纹理缓存精度"为"低"提升性能
- 尝试不同的"各向异性过滤"级别
Citra性能设置界面示意图
专家提示:使用Citra的"帧率显示"功能(在"视图"菜单中开启)监控性能变化。稳定的30fps通常是3DS游戏的目标,大多数游戏在这个帧率下体验最佳。
掌握高级功能:解锁模拟器全部潜力
Citra提供了许多高级功能,帮助你获得更好的游戏体验:
存档管理
- 使用"导出存档"功能备份游戏进度
- 通过"导入存档"在不同设备间转移进度
- 利用"即时存档"功能在任何时刻保存游戏状态
画质增强
- 启用"纹理替换"使用高清游戏纹理
- 调整"后期处理"效果提升画面质量
- 尝试"拉伸至窗口"或"保持纵横比"显示模式
专家提示:社区创建的高清纹理包可以显著提升游戏视觉效果,但会增加显卡负担。建议根据硬件性能选择性使用。
性能测试记录表
使用以下表格记录不同游戏的性能表现,帮助你找到最佳配置方案:
| 游戏名称 | 分辨率设置 | 后端选择 | 平均帧率 | 遇到的问题 | 优化方案 |
|---|---|---|---|---|---|
| 游戏A | 2x | Vulkan | 28fps | 偶尔卡顿 | 禁用硬件着色器 |
| 游戏B | 1x | OpenGL | 30fps | 无明显问题 | - |
| 游戏C | 4x | Vulkan | 15fps | 严重掉帧 | 降低分辨率至2x |
使用说明:每测试一个游戏,记录默认设置下的表现,然后尝试不同配置并记录变化。这将帮助你建立针对不同类型游戏的优化策略。
通过本指南的学习,你已经掌握了Citra模拟器的核心使用技巧和优化方法。从环境评估到高级功能,每个环节都有其关键要点。记住,模拟器配置是一个不断尝试和调整的过程,适合别人的设置不一定适合你的硬件环境。不断实践和优化,你一定能找到最适合自己的3DS游戏电脑运行方案,重温那些经典的3DS游戏。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ust099-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00